Carol Stephenson has resigned as president of Lucent Technologies Canada. She had held the position since July 1999. Stephenson will be replaced by Alex Giosa. Two years ago, the Canadian arm of Lucent Technologies Inc. emerged unscathed from the parent company’s significant restructuring south of the border. In January 2001, Stephenson told Report on Wireless that the company was ready to capitalize on a strong 2000 (RoW, Jan. 8/01). The reasons surrounding her departure are still unknown, but a prolonged slump in the telecom equipment sector couldn’t have made the situation any easier.
